Common Summer Pests in Commercial Properties
Different sectors face unique pest pressures, but the summer months typically see a rise in the following pests across Northern England:
Flies
Flies are among the most widespread summer pests, particularly in restaurants, cafés, food production sites, and healthcare settings. Without proper measures such as flyscreens and electric fly killers, they can quickly contaminate food preparation and front-of-house areas, spreading bacteria and causing discomfort for staff and visitors.
Wasps
Wasp activity reaches its peak during summer. Nests located near entrances, outdoor seating areas, loading bays, or roof spaces can present a serious hazard to employees, customers, and visitors.
Ants
Warmer conditions drive ants to search for food and water. They often infiltrate kitchens, staff areas, washrooms, and storage spaces, creating hygiene issues and potential disruption to daily operations.
Rodents (Rats and Mice)
While rodents are a year-round concern, summer provides plentiful food sources and ideal conditions for nesting. Rats and mice can contaminate goods, spread disease, and cause significant damage to wiring, insulation, and infrastructure.
Cockroaches
Cockroaches thrive in warm, humid environments and can multiply rapidly during summer. They are especially problematic in food service environments, hospitality venues, and multi-occupancy commercial buildings.
Why Pest Control Matters More in Summer
As temperatures rise, pests become more active and reproduce at a faster rate. Open doors and windows, increased footfall, and outdoor dining areas can all provide easy access to commercial premises.
Without a proactive pest management plan, businesses can face serious consequences, including:
- Health code violations and failed inspections
- Damage to inventory, equipment, and infrastructure
- Loss of customers, tenants, or business opportunities
- Legal liability and reputational damage
- Disruption to day-to-day operations

Summer Pest Prevention Tips for Businesses
Alongside professional pest control services, businesses can reduce the risk of summer infestations by:
- Keeping doors closed where possible or installing flyscreens and fly killers
- Emptying bins regularly and maintaining clean waste storage areas
- Promptly cleaning food spills and removing standing water
- Sealing gaps around doors, windows, and service entry points
- Scheduling routine pest inspections during the warmer months
Taking preventative action now can save significant time, money, and disruption later.
